How is the initial token distribution determined for a public blockchain?
Simon ElijahAug 16, 2025 · 8 months ago3 answers
Can you explain how the initial token distribution is determined for a public blockchain? What factors are taken into consideration?
3 answers
- Raul ManasevichNov 15, 2022 · 3 years agoThe initial token distribution for a public blockchain is typically determined through a process called an initial coin offering (ICO). During an ICO, the project team sells a certain amount of tokens to early investors in exchange for funding. The distribution of tokens can also be influenced by factors such as the project's goals, the team's vision, and the overall market demand for the token. It's important for the project team to strike a balance between attracting enough investors to raise sufficient funds and ensuring a fair distribution of tokens to avoid concentration in the hands of a few individuals or entities.
- T DorjsambuuJul 11, 2021 · 5 years agoWhen it comes to determining the initial token distribution for a public blockchain, it's all about finding the right balance. The project team needs to consider various factors such as the token's utility, the project's goals, and the overall market conditions. They want to attract enough investors to raise funds for development, but they also want to ensure that the tokens are distributed fairly. This can be achieved through mechanisms like a token sale or airdrops, where tokens are given away for free to a wide range of individuals. By doing so, the project team can create a diverse and decentralized community of token holders.
